Licensing Requirements for Casino Operators

Obtaining a license is a fundamental step for any entity wishing to operate a casino. The licensing process often involves a thorough background check of the operators and their financial records, which can take considerable time and effort. Each jurisdiction has its own specific requirements, and it is essential for prospective casino operators to understand what documentation and standards they must meet.

Furthermore, maintaining a license is an ongoing commitment. Casinos are typically subject to periodic audits and must adhere to strict operational standards. Failure to comply can result in penalties, including fines or loss of the operating license, making adherence to regulations a top priority for casino management.

Player Protections and Responsible Gaming Regulations

In addition to regulations governing casino operations, there are laws aimed at protecting players. These regulations often include measures for responsible gaming, which promote safe gambling practices and provide resources for those struggling with addiction. Casinos are required to implement programs and policies to ensure that players can gamble responsibly.

Ensuring player safety is not only a legal obligation but also a moral one. Many jurisdictions mandate that casinos provide information on responsible gaming, including self-exclusion programs and contact details for support services. By adhering to these regulations, casinos not only comply with the law but also foster trust and goodwill within the gaming community.

Advertising and Marketing Regulations

The marketing strategies employed by casinos are also heavily regulated. Authorities often impose restrictions on how casinos can promote their services to ensure that advertising is truthful and not misleading. This includes limitations on targeting vulnerable populations, such as minors or individuals with known gambling problems.

Moreover, casinos must navigate the fine line between enticing promotions and responsible advertising. Many jurisdictions require clear disclosures regarding the terms of bonuses and promotions, ensuring that potential players are fully informed before participating. Understanding these marketing regulations is essential for casinos aiming to build a reputable brand while remaining compliant.
